Cognition AI Clinches $500 Million to Revolutionize Code Generation
Cognition AI Inc. has secured a whopping $500 million in new funding, catapulting the AI startup's valuation to nearly $9.8 billion. Renowned for its flagship product Devin, which autonomously handles the full software development lifecycle, Cognition aims to dominate the AI code‑generation sphere with minimal human intervention. The Series C funding round coincides with its strategic acquisition of Windsurf Inc., bolstering its position against industry giants.
